Retiring my Hobby Lobby B25 before it gets trashed lol. Just gonna hang it up for display. Taking the engines and speed controls off and putting them in a couple of planes Im building from a kit from a guy in Florida. He laser cuts them his self. Im just about finished with one Im building for him. Ill post some pictures as soon as this thing will accept them lol been trying to post this for several times now. Its 50" wing span with a high lift wing for STOL. He calls it the Stollite. Fully loaded, 1.75 lbs and they are using them to tow up 100" gliders. Dont know what motor or battery he is using. Im just gonna fly mine for fun. Probably have mine ready in couple weeks for maiden. My son gets the other one. Will keep you guys posted.
